The Ampeg Heritage 50th Anniversary SVT is a limited-edition all-tube 300-watt bass amp head celebrating five decades of the SVT, incorporating both 1969 Blueline and 1975 Blackline circuits as two independently voiced channels. Channel 1 reproduces the original 1969 SVT tone that launched the series, similar to the SVT Classic, while Channel 2 is voiced from a hand-selected mid-1970s unit for greater attack, clarity, and high-end definition. Modern additions include an enhanced XLR DI output, user-biasing for simplified tube maintenance, a quiet cooling fan, and Neutrik speakOn connections. It represents the most historically comprehensive SVT reproduction Ampeg has released.
